eclipse-sdk-3.2_rc3-r1 compiles cleanly as does rc2, but still crashes when 
used on ppc with ibm-jdk-bin as the jvm for eclipse.  There is no problem 
actually using ibm-jdk within eclipse for projects..

I have been using gcj as the jvm for eclipse.  ibm-jdk acquires between 20M 
and 50M upon startup, while gcj uses 100M+, currently using 123M.  Perhaps it 
is a memory problem.  Though I have tried  to start ecllpse with more memory 
the ibm jdk does not seem to accept it.

When I first compiled rc3 I did not modify with -compilelibs and it seemed 
quite slow, but the second time I did, now eclipse seems relatively speedy 
after startup.
